When it comes to harsh environments and high temperatures, having the right material for the job is essential This is where high temperature PTFE comes into play PTFE, or polytetrafluoroethylene, is a synthetic polymer that is known for its excellent chemical and heat resistance High temperature PTFE takes this one step further by being specifically designed to withstand extreme temperatures, making it an ideal choice for a wide range of applications.
High temperature PTFE is a versatile material that offers a number of benefits over other materials when it comes to high temperature environments One of the key advantages of high temperature PTFE is its ability to maintain its properties even at temperatures as high as 260°C This makes it ideal for use in applications where traditional materials would fail, such as in industrial ovens, chemical processing plants, and automotive components.
In addition to its high temperature resistance, high temperature PTFE also boasts excellent chemical resistance This means that it can withstand exposure to a wide range of corrosive chemicals without degrading or breaking down This makes it perfect for use in applications where contact with harsh chemicals is common, such as in chemical processing plants and laboratories.
Another key benefit of high temperature PTFE is its low friction properties PTFE is well known for its low coefficient of friction, which means that it has little resistance to the flow of liquids or gases across its surface This makes it ideal for use in applications where friction needs to be minimized, such as in bearings, seals, and gaskets.

Its low dielectric constant and high dielectric strength make it ideal for use in electrical insulation applications, such as in cables, connectors, and electronic components.
One of the most common uses for high temperature PTFE is in the production of heat-resistant tape This tape is used in a wide range of applications, from insulating electrical wires to sealing high temperature components Its ability to withstand extreme temperatures makes it an ideal choice for these types of applications, where failure could result in serious damage or injury.
High temperature PTFE is also used in the production of gaskets, seals, and packings for a wide variety of industrial applications Its ability to withstand high temperatures and harsh chemicals makes it an ideal choice for use in sealing applications where traditional materials might fail.
In addition to its high temperature resistance and chemical resistance, high temperature PTFE is also highly durable and long-lasting Its excellent mechanical properties mean that it can withstand the rigors of industrial use without breaking down or degrading This makes it a cost-effective choice for a wide range of applications where longevity and performance are key.
